Nonlocality Of A Single Particle Demonstrated
thisnamecantbetaken
by thisnamecantbetaken  11-19-2007    3
  The single-state nonlocality demonstrated here reinforces the equivalence of a single state and an entangled state—giving more credence to the position that quantum field theory, where fields are fundamental and particles secondary, is a close representation of reality. If we wish to maintain the view that reality exists independent of our measurements (e.g. the moon is there even if we don’t look at it), we are forced to accept that the world is nonlocal.
